In the Wendon Valley of Southland, life in the 1950s and 60s was shaped by land, weather, family and community. It was a hard place to make a living, but a rich place to grow up.

In Echoes of a Wendon Valley Boy, Doug Miller reflects on his childhood and teenage years with humour and affection. From farm work and fishing to boarding school days, local characters and a large extended family, these stories capture the texture of rural life and the people who defined it.

Written decades later, the book is also about identity and the importance of recording ordinary lives before they fade. Doug writes not to romanticise the past, but to understand it, and to honour the people and place that shaped him.

This is a thoughtful and quietly powerful portrait of a changing New Zealand, told from one remote valley but resonating far beyond it.
